@@harubaru4912 in Dragon Age Origins, the Circle of Magi in Fereldan is overrun by demons. You meet Cullen in there either when you go to free the Circle or meet him as a mage origin at the beginning. If you’re a female mage, he has a crush on the your warden. When you get to the Circle to kill the demons, he’s been tortured for days from demons and by with poking through his mind and keeping him from eating and drinking and seeing all his friends go crazy and die and he’s the last Templar in the top area alive. In Dragon Age 2, he is the Knight Captain of the Templar’s in Kirkwall and had a lot of fun ins with Hawke. He’s traumatized and is a lot harsher in his views of mages and seeing them as monsters in this game because of it. He mentions his regrets and all in Inquisition and his trauma. Being surrounded by all those people and harassed and assaulted is already terrible but also could be very similar to the demons against him especially if he had a crush on a mage warden.
